  • could you explain why a number to a negative power is the inverse raised to that power? i've searched online, but the general message is "because that's the way it is."

  • It is a definition that is consistent with the exponent property that (x^a)*(x^b) = x^(a+b).

    2^3*2^3 =8*8 = 64 = 2^6

    2*3*2^-3 = 8*1/8 = 1 = 2^(3-3) = 2^0

    You can look at the exponent property videos for more info.
